Horse Stall Repair in Olathe, KS
Horse stall repair services involve restoring and maintaining existing horse stalls to ensure they remain safe, functional, and durable. Projects typically include fixing broken or damaged stall walls, replacing worn-out fencing, repairing gates, and addressing issues with flooring or drainage. Property owners often seek these services after noticing structural weaknesses, damage from wear and tear, or after weather-related incidents that compromise the stability of the stalls. Understanding the scope of the repair needed and the condition of the existing structures helps in planning effective solutions that support the safety and well-being of the horses.
Before requesting horse stall repair services, property owners should assess the extent of the damage and identify specific areas that require attention. It’s helpful to consider the age of the existing structures, the materials used, and any recurring problems such as rot, rust, or pest damage. Clear communication about the type of repairs needed and the desired outcome can facilitate a smoother process. Proper evaluation ensures that repairs address current issues and prevent future problems, maintaining the integrity of the stall environment for both horses and caretakers.

Common Horse Stall Repair Jobs
Horse stall repair involves fixing damaged or worn stall walls and partitions to ensure safety and stability.
Structural reinforcement addresses sagging or broken stall components to prevent accidents and improve durability.
Wood replacement involves installing new panels or framing to restore the stall’s integrity and appearance.
Hardware and latch repair ensures gates and doors operate smoothly and securely.
Flooring repairs focus on fixing cracked or uneven surfaces to provide a safe footing for horses.
Waterproofing and sealing protect stall materials from moisture damage and extend their lifespan.
Horse Stall Repair Questions
What types of horse stall repairs are commonly needed? Common repairs include fixing broken stall boards, replacing damaged doors, and addressing structural issues to ensure safety and stability.
How can I tell if my horse stall needs repairs? Signs include loose or broken boards, gaps, sagging doors, or any structural damage that impacts the stall's security and safety.
Are there specific materials used for horse stall repairs? Durable materials like treated wood, galvanized metal, and heavy-duty hardware are typically used to ensure longevity and safety.
What should property owners consider before repairing a horse stall? It's important to evaluate the extent of damage, choose appropriate materials, and ensure repairs meet safety standards for horses and handlers.
